3.Santorini Island: Greece has declared a state of emergency on Santorini as frequent earthquakes shake the island and nearby Aegean islands multiple times a day.
About: Santorini Island (Thera) is a volcanic crater island that is located in Southern Aegean Sea, southeastern Greece.
o Island Group: Southernmost in the Cyclades, ~128 nautical miles SE of Greek mainland, ~63 nautical miles N of Crete.
o Volcanic Origin: Part of an exploded volcano, forming the South Aegean Volcanic Arc.
o Active Volcano: One of the few active volcanoes in Greece & Europe. Caldera, A sea-filled volcanic caldera with steep, colorful cliffs on three sides.
o Famous for whitewashed houses, blue waters, dramatic views, and fabulous sunsets. Home to the ancient settlement of Thira.
